编程中nfts是什么意思

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    NFTs是非同质化代币(Non-Fungible Tokens)的缩写。它是一种加密货币技术,用于在区块链上表示和交易数字资产。与传统的加密货币(如比特币、以太坊)不同,NFTs代表的是独一无二的数字资产,这使得它们在艺术、游戏、娱乐和虚拟现实等领域具有广泛的应用价值。

    NFTs使用区块链技术确保每个代币的唯一性、真实性和不可替代性。每个NFT都有自己的元数据,包含了有关该代币的详细信息,在区块链上不可篡改。这意味着艺术品或其他数字资产的拥有者可以证明他们拥有正版、原始的作品,而其他人无法伪造或重复创建。

    NFTs的流通和交易通常发生在区块链市场上,例如OpenSea、Rarible等平台。在这些市场上,用户可以购买、出售或交易各种类型的NFTs,包括艺术品、音乐、视频、虚拟地产等。NFTs的交易价格往往取决于其稀缺性、品质和市场需求。

    近年来,NFTs在艺术界引起了极大的关注和兴趣。艺术家可以通过将自己的作品转化为NFTs,实现作品的数字化和全球范围内的售卖。同时,NFTs还为艺术家提供了更多的收益机会,例如通过二次销售获得版税。

    除了艺术领域,NFTs还在游戏、娱乐和虚拟现实等领域得到广泛运用。在游戏中,NFTs可以代表虚拟道具、角色或游戏内的资产,允许用户在不同游戏之间交换和转移。此外,NFTs还可以用于虚拟现实世界的拥有权和身份验证。

    总的来说,NFTs是一种创新的加密货币技术,使得数字资产能够以独特、不可替代的方式存在和流通。它在艺术、游戏和虚拟现实领域带来了新的商机和创作方式,同时也带来了对数字资产所有权和身份验证的新思考。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,NFTs是非同质化代币(Non-Fungible Tokens)的缩写。非同质化代币是一种基于区块链技术的数字资产,每个代币都具有唯一性和独特性,与其他代币不可替代。与之相反,可互换的代币(如比特币或以太币)是相互可替代的,每个单位都具有相同的价值。

    以下是关于NFTs的一些重要点:

    1. 独特性:每个NFT都是独一无二的,具有独特的特征和价值。通常,它们表示艺术品、数字收藏品、虚拟地产或其他数字资产。

    2. 区块链技术:NFTs基于区块链技术构建,常用的区块链包括以太坊(Ethereum)和波卡(Polkadot)。区块链确保了NFT的所有权和可追溯性,使其在数字艺术、游戏和虚拟现实等领域具有广泛应用。

    3. 所有权和交易:区块链技术允许NFT的所有权得以验证和传输,而无需中介或第三方的干预。NFT可以在市场上进行买卖、拍卖和交易,使创作者和持有者能够实现价值转移。

    4. 智能合约:NFTs依赖智能合约来定义和实现资产的属性、交易规则和所有权验证。智能合约是在区块链上运行的自动化合约,确保NFT的可编程性和可靠性。

    5. 艺术与创意领域:NFTs在艺术、娱乐和文化创意领域引起了广泛关注。创作者可以通过NFT销售自己的艺术作品,粉丝和收藏家则可以购买和持有独特的数字收藏品。这为艺术家和创作者提供了新的收入来源和与粉丝互动的机会。

    总之,NFTs是一种基于区块链技术的数字资产,具有独一无二的特征和价值。它们在艺术、娱乐和文化创意领域具有广泛的应用,为创作者和收藏家提供了新的机会和体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    NFTs,全称为Non-Fungible Tokens,即非同质化代币。它们是建立在区块链技术上的数字资产,每一个NFT都是独一无二的,与其他NFTs有所区别和不可替代性。

    与普通的加密货币(如比特币或以太币)不同,这些加密货币是可互换的,即一种货币可以被替换为另一种货币,没有明显的区别。但是,NFTs代表的是独特的资产,每一个NFT都有其独特的属性、价值和身份。这使得NFTs在数字艺术、游戏道具、虚拟地产等领域具有广泛的应用。

    NFTs的价值和真实性是通过区块链技术进行验证和保证的。区块链是一个去中心化的分布式账本,每个NFT都以唯一的ID作为标识,并记录在区块链的交易记录中。这样,无论是购买、销售还是交易NFT,都可以被明确地记录下来,保证了NFT的真实性和所有权。

    NFTs的流通和交易是通过智能合约实现的。智能合约是在区块链上运行的编程代码,可以自动执行和履行合约中设定的条件。通过智能合约,可以定义NFT的所有权、交易方式、价格等细节。

    在编程中使用NFTs,首先需要选择合适的区块链平台,如以太坊,它具有广泛的NFT支持。然后,您可以使用合适的编程语言(如Solidity)来编写智能合约,并定义NFT的属性、交易逻辑等。编写合约后,您可以将NFTs部署到区块链上,并通过调用智能合约来实现NFT的购买、销售和交易。

    为了提供更好的用户体验,还可以开发NFT市场平台或集成NFT功能到现有的应用程序中。这样,用户可以方便地浏览和交易NFTs,而不必直接与智能合约进行交互。

    总而言之,NFTs是建立在区块链技术上的独特数字资产,每一个NFT都是独一无二的。在编程中,您可以使用合适的区块链平台和编程语言来创建和交易NFTs,并通过智能合约来管理NFT的属性、所有权和交易。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部